Description

REACH is a community health centre that has been located on the east side of Vancouver since 1969 We became incorporated as a nonprofit society in 1970 with a Board of Directors comprised primarily of community members and patients of the clinic

Since its inception REACH has endeavoured to meet the medical dental and cultural needs of the community with an emphasis on prevention and the development of programs which reflect the ongoing needs of the ever changing composition of the community REACH strives to reflect the philosophy of community health centres which promotes a team approach in a nonprofit setting with all staff including dentists and physicians on salary

The community of which REACH is a part is a richly diversified ethnic setting in the area known as Grandview Woodlands Many of the residents have a lower than average income with a high level of single parent family households REACH has adopted the definition of health as The extent to which an individual or group is able on one hand to realize aspirations and satisfy needs and on the other hand to change or cope with the environment Our community health centre strives to incorporate this definition of health in its culturally sensitive programs and interdisciplinary approach to the delivery of services REACH has a strong commitment to community development and works to build a collaborative relationship with users of the clinic There is an equally strong commitment on behalf of the staff to illustrate an openness and acceptance of the ethnic cultural and social diversity which is found in our community

How REACH Works

REACH is more than just a doctor or dentists office We offer many health and social services with interdisciplinary teams under one roof As a nonprofit society we are directly accountable to the community we serve and are governed by a Board of Directors Our mission is to improve the health and wellbeing of our community and our focus is on accessibility and excellence in primary health care

REACH emphasizes prevention health promotion health education and community development services The Grandview Woodlands community is richly diverse REACH prioritizes the use of our resources to mesh with the needs of members of our community REACH is a place where members of the community staff board and volunteers feel equally welcomed listened to and respected

Our staff board and volunteers are resource people to our community We aim to assist the community in making informed decisions about health and overcome the social barriers to health REACH places a high value on democratic decision making with input from the board staff those who use the centre and our community Our doctors and dentists provide oncall service 24 hours a day 7 days a week REACH remunerates staff including doctors and dentists by salary
